> I'm happy to announce that the new Apache Iceberg site is officially
> deployed to https://iceberg.apache.org!
>
> Thanks to all who participated in design discussions and reviews along the
> way. I will be fixing up the automation and documentation and provide
> instructions on how to update, validate, and deploy the documentation.
>
> Few things to note, there are likely a few links that were changed or
> updated from before. Please report any of these in The Iceberg Issues:
> https://github.com/apache/iceberg/issues. Thanks to Kevin Liu for already
> reporting the Catalog page issues:
> https://github.com/apache/iceberg/pull/9642. Please keep a lookout for
> these issues and feel free to report any styling and CSS issues on the new
> site here: https://github.com/apache/iceberg/issues/9643
>
> Please note that we will no longer be submitting to the
> https://github.com/apache/iceberg-docs repository. I will submit a ticket
> to ASF INFRA to archive the repository and mark as read-only. There are
> very few pull requests that should be relatively simple to migrate over and
> I will also be following up with those individuals.
